解决苹果企业签名过期的快速方法
解决苹果企业签名过期的快速方法,苹果企业签名是许多开发者和企业在绕过 App Store 审核时的常用分发方式,但企业签名证书有一定的有效期,一旦过期,签名的应用将无法正常运行,用户会遇到闪退或无法打开的情况。为了避免影响用户体验,企业需要在签名过期前后采取快速有效的措施进行处理。
本文将详细介绍苹果企业签名过期后的解决方案及预防方法,帮助开发者和企业迅速恢复正常分发。
一、苹果企业签名过期的原因
企业签名过期通常由以下原因导致:
- 证书有效期到期
苹果开发者企业账号的签名证书通常有效期为一年,到期后需续费并重新签名。 - 证书被苹果吊销
因违反苹果开发者政策(如滥用证书、过度分发)而导致证书被吊销。 - 开发者账号未续费
开发者未按时支付企业开发者账号的年费,导致账号被暂停。
二、快速解决苹果企业签名过期的方法
1. 更换新证书重新签名
- 操作步骤:
- 准备新的企业开发者账号或合作服务商的签名证书。
- 使用新的证书对应用进行重新签名。
- 将重新签名后的应用包分发给用户,通过链接或二维码引导用户下载安装。
- 注意事项:
- 确保新的证书合法有效,避免重复出现掉签问题。
- 提醒用户卸载旧版应用,以防签名冲突。
2. 续费原企业开发者账号
- 如果企业签名因未续费导致证书过期,可以通过续费恢复账号有效性:
- 登录苹果开发者官网,进入企业账号管理页面。
- 按照提示完成年费支付。
- 使用续费后的证书重新签名应用并分发。
- 注意事项:
- 续费后,签名应用需要重新安装。
3. 使用备用签名证书
- 操作步骤:
- 如果企业提前准备了备用证书(备用开发者账号),可立即启用备用签名。
- 使用备用证书签名应用,更新分发链接。
- 优势:
- 备用证书可迅速切换,减少应用中断时间。
4. 使用超级签名或 TF 签名过渡
- 在企业签名证书更新期间,可暂时使用超级签名或 TestFlight(TF 签名)分发应用:
- 超级签名:利用个人开发者账号分发应用,快速生成有效签名。
- TestFlight:通过苹果官方的内测平台发布应用。
- 适用场景:
- 紧急情况下的短期过渡,适合小范围用户分发。
5. 联系专业签名服务商
- 如果企业缺乏开发者账号或签名技术,可寻求第三方苹果签名服务商的帮助。
- 服务商优势:
- 提供稳定的签名证书。
- 快速响应掉签问题,减少用户影响。
三、如何预防企业签名过期问题
- 设置签名到期提醒
- 在签名证书到期前 1-2 个月设置提醒,及时续费或更换签名证书。
- 备份备用证书
- 准备多个企业开发者账号或签名证书,在主账号或证书失效时能迅速切换。
- 合理分发应用
- 控制签名应用的分发范围,避免因过度分发而引发苹果审查,降低证书被吊销的风险。
- 监控证书状态
- 使用专业的分发平台或工具,实时监控签名状态,一旦发现异常可及时处理。
- 与可靠的签名服务商合作
- 选择有信誉和经验的第三方签名服务商,提供稳定的签名服务并支持掉签补救。
四、总结
苹果企业签名过期是一个不可忽视的问题,会直接影响应用的正常分发和用户体验。通过提前做好证书管理、设置提醒和准备备用方案,企业可以最大限度地降低签名过期带来的风险。同时,在证书过期后,及时采取措施进行恢复,能够有效减少对用户和业务的影响。
对于长期需求的企业,与可靠的签名服务商合作,或考虑多种分发方式结合使用(如企业签名+超级签名+TF签名),可以更好地保障分发的稳定性和安全性。